Szybkie wsparcie: 511 280 732 lub [email protected]
Dominik Krawiec ✅ Ekspert SEO & WordPress

Jak ukryć widgety na mobile w WordPress?

Brakuje ci miejsca na ekranie mobilnym w WordPress? Jednym ze sposobów jest ukrycie niepotrzebnych widgetów na urządzeniach przenośnych. Jak to zrobić skutecznie, nie tracąc funkcjonalności strony?

Po co tracisz czas?

Ciągłe wprowadzanie poprawek na swojej stronie to uciążliwe zajęcie.
Z pewnością masz ważniejsze sprawy na głowie.
Zadbam o Twojego WordPressa.

... jeśli koniecznie chcesz zrobić to samodzielnie

Wykonaj poniższe kroki.

Użycie wtyczki do zarządzania widocznością widgetów

Jedną z najprostszych metod ukrycia widgetów na urządzeniach mobilnych w WordPressie jest skorzystanie z wtyczki. Przykładem tego typu rozszerzenia jest „Widget Options”. Dzięki niej można precyzyjnie zdecydować, które elementy będą widoczne na różnych urządzeniach.

widget options wordpress

Po zainstalowaniu i aktywacji wtyczki, odwiedź sekcję widgetów w panelu administracyjnym WordPressa. Przy każdym widgetie zauważysz dodatkowe opcje. Wybierz odpowiednią zakładkę, na której można określić, czy ma być widoczny na komputerach czy urządzeniach mobilnych.

Zarządzanie widocznością widgetów za pomocą tej wtyczki jest bardzo intuicyjne. Możesz nie tylko ukrywać widgety, ale również ustawiać, na jakich typach stron (np. strona główna, wpisy bloga) mają się one pojawiać. Dzięki temu masz pełną kontrolę nad prezentacją treści.

Choć korzystanie z wtyczek jest niezwykle wygodne, warto zwrócić uwagę na dodatkowe obciążenie strony. Każda dodatkowa wtyczka zwiększa czas ładowania strony i może wpływać na jej ogólną wydajność. Ważne jest również regularne aktualizowanie wtyczek, aby uniknąć potencjalnych problemów z bezpieczeństwem.

Zalety tej metody to prosta obsługa i możliwość precyzyjnego dopasowania widoczności widgetów. Wady to dodatkowe obciążenie strony oraz konieczność regularnego aktualizowania wtyczek.

Dodanie niestandardowego CSS

Inną metodą ukrycia widgetów na urządzeniach mobilnych jest dodanie niestandardowego CSS. To podejście wymaga pewnej wiedzy technicznej, ale jest bardziej elastyczne i nie obciąża strony dodatkową wtyczką.

Aby ukryć widgety za pomocą CSS, najpierw zidentyfikuj unikalny identyfikator lub klasę widgetu, który chcesz ukryć. Możesz to zrobić, przeglądając kod HTML strony za pomocą narzędzi deweloperskich w przeglądarce.

Po zidentyfikowaniu odpowiednich identyfikatorów, dodaj poniższy kod CSS do sekcji „Dostosuj” w WordPressie:

@media only screen and (max-width: 768px) {
    #unikalny-id-widgetu {
        display: none;
    }
}

Ten kod ukrywa określony widget na ekranach o szerokości mniejszej niż 768px, co obejmuje większość urządzeń mobilnych.

Dzięki tej metodzie masz pełną kontrolę nad wyglądem strony. Możesz dowolnie modyfikować kod CSS, aby dostosować stronę do różnych rozdzielczości ekranów. Nie obciążasz też strony dodatkową wtyczką.

Zaletą tej metody jest lekkość i większa kontrola nad wyglądem strony. Wadą może być konieczność posiadania podstawowej wiedzy z zakresu CSS oraz regularne aktualizowanie kodu w przypadku zmian na stronie.

Korzystanie z kodu PHP w functions.php

Trzecią metodą jest ukrycie widgetów za pomocą kodu PHP w pliku functions.php. To rozwiązanie jest przeznaczone dla osób dobrze zaznajomionych z programowaniem w WordPressie, ale jest bardzo efektywne.

Aby zastosować tę metodę, otwórz plik functions.php swojego motywu i dodaj poniższy kod:

function ukryj_widgety_na_mobile($params) {
    if (wp_is_mobile()) {
        $widget_id = $params[0]['id'];
        $widgety_do_ukrycia = array('recent-posts', 'categories'); // Podaj ID widgetów, które chcesz ukryć

        if (in_array($widget_id, $widgety_do_ukrycia)) {
            return false;
        }
    }
    return $params;
}
add_filter('dynamic_sidebar_params', 'ukryj_widgety_na_mobile');

Ten kod sprawi, że określone widgety będą ukryte na urządzeniach mobilnych. Możesz łatwo edytować listę widgety_do_ukrycia, aby dodać lub usunąć widgety.

Użycie tej metody daje duże możliwości dostosowania, umożliwiając dynamiczne zarządzanie widocznością widgetów. Możesz również dodać inne warunki, aby jeszcze bardziej precyzyjnie dostosować wyświetlanie widgetów.

Zaletą tej metody jest duża elastyczność i brak dodatkowego obciążenia strony. Wadą jest konieczność znajomości PHP oraz ryzyko wprowadzenia błędów, które mogą wpłynąć na działanie strony.

Każda z tych metod ma swoje mocne i słabe strony. Wybór odpowiedniej metody zależy od poziomu twojego doświadczenia oraz indywidualnych potrzeb twojej strony.

Podsumowanie

Ukrywanie widgetów wiąże się również z wpływem na SEO i UX (User Experience). Warto zastanowić się, czy ukrycie konkretnego widgetu nie wpłynie negatywnie na odbiór strony przez użytkowników oraz czy nie spowoduje obniżenia pozycji w wynikach wyszukiwania.

Nie bój się testować różnych rozwiązań i przeprowadzaj analizę, aby upewnić się, że strona działa optymalnie na wszystkich urządzeniach. Warto korzystać z narzędzi do analizy ruchu, aby dokładnie sprawdzić, jak ukrycie widgetów wpłynęło na zachowanie użytkowników.

Możliwość ukrywania widgetów daje wielką swobodę w projektowaniu stron responsywnych. Jednak pamiętaj o konsekwencjach, jak spadek zaangażowania użytkowników czy ewentualne problemy z indeksowaniem przez wyszukiwarki.

Zrozumienie tych aspektów pomoże Ci uniknąć pułapek i maksymalnie zoptymalizować swoją stronę. Ostatecznie ważne jest, aby podejmować decyzje odpowiadające potrzebom zarówno użytkowników, jak i algorytmów wyszukiwarek.

Zadbam o Twoją stronę internetową

Wypełnij poniższy formularz - odezwę się do Ciebie, by porozmawiać o Twojej stronie internetowej.



    Wysyłając wiadomość, akceptujesz politykę prywatności i wyrażasz zgodę na przetwarzanie podanych danych osobowych w celu przygotowania oferty.
    🔒 Twoje dane są bezpieczne.

    Copyright 2024 WooCado - Opieka nad stroną Polityka prywatności